I wouldn't even recommend Sim City 4 to a new Sim City person, it is quite a bit more involved than the others - brilliant game but perhaps the least accessible to someone new to the franchise.
I'd probably go for Sim City 3 as a starting point unless you don't mind a pretty big learning curve.

I really liked Sim City Societies. No, it wasn't the SC5 that everyone was looking for and it was somewhat simplistic, but it was still enjoyable. I still play it from time to time.
Because the game didn't go over very well with the Sim City community, there are very few mods for it. What little there is, can be found will be at the Tilted Mill forums. (http://www.tiltedmill.com/forums/forumdisplay.php?f=35)
